Bill Nye the Science Guy is a widely-viewed, children's television series on science. Designed for eight-to-ten year olds, this series is shown in late afternoons Monday through Friday on PBS stations and on commercial television over the weekends. Rockman et al, an independent research group in San Francisco, was contracted by KCTS, Seattle, WA, to undertake an evaluation of the Bill Nye the Science Guy television series. Research Communications Ltd. will develop research designs, measurement, and analysis techniques for the assessment of the impacts of informal science learning television programming and other media. Experts in the fields of psychology, science education, communications research, and evaluation and testing will develop methodologies and instruments to: better assess impact on attitudes, cognition, and behavior for specific audiences, take into account the idea that informal science learning may take a variety of forms, and better assess cumulative impacts of television and other media on informal science learning. The PI's for the project will be Valerie Crane, President of RCL, and Beth Rabin and Suzanne Carter, both on the RCL staff. Advisors would include experts in research on children's television programming such as Ellen Wartella and Keith Mielke, specialists in inquiry-based learning and formal and informal science curricula such as Matthew Schneps, and specialists in evaluation and testing such as Edward Chittenden.

National Public Radio (NPR) has been awarded a grant of $807,335 in declining amounts over a four year period for production of Science Friday, the weekly two-hour call-in radio show that deals with science topics. Over the four year period, NPR will make an increasingly larger commitment to the total budget of $1,763,768 until they assume total budgetary responsibility for the project in FY 2001. The series' goal is to make science easily accessible to the public and to help them realize the relevance of science and technology to everyday life. The format of the programs enables the public to engage in conversations with scientists and science educators to discuss contemporary science topics. Science issues anticipated to be included in future programs include: science and mathematics education, science literacy, science risk assessment and public policy, and the future of technology. In addition to the broadcast series, NPR will develop a web site for Science Friday which will distribute the radio series on demand via the Internet, bring Science Friday to cities and rural areas where the series is not broadcast, create live Internet chat groups where listeners can meet to discuss the program, provide sound bytes and audio files of guests, and create a "Science Day Book" which will be a calendar of events loaded with science opportunities for people in their own home towns. Science Friday also has established a joint project with Kidsnet, an established computerized clearinghouse for education through the media. Ira Flatow will continue as the series host and producer. Barbara Flagg of Multimedia Research has been engaged to assess the audience impact of the project.

This project will explore new ways to reach a broadcast audience wider than those who normally would watch an NSF funded television program on PBS. The PI will define new, non-competitive relationships between PBS and other broadcast or cable venues and will explore incentives for pursuing such relationships. The specific tasks to be conducted under the grant include: developing and testing procedures for distributing a program or series in a venue in addition to PBS, implementing such distribution, and evaluating the impact on audience size in the new venue as well as on subsequent broadcast on PBS. The final report will document the results of this research and describe the steps required to arrange for multiple venues. This project represents examination of an untested idea, the results of which may establish the basis for significantly increasing the impact of broadcast programming supported by NSF. Traditionally, when PBS has agreed to schedule a program or series, they have insisted on a window of exclusivity for a period three years. If the data from this project indicates that broadcast of a PBS program in a new venue reaches new audiences and, potentially, attracts some of that audience to PBS, it should establish a more open attitude on the part of PBS toward multiple venues at a much earlier time.

This project creates and implements a national parent engagement and education campaign. It provides a framework for all parents to explore existing and alternative forms of assessment within the context of changes in current classroom math curriculum and practices. The campaign also provides a mechanism for enhancing communication between teachers, schools and parents in order to ensure support for math strategies and practices by all members of learning communities nationwide. Project products include: * A thirty-minute documentary on mathematics reform and assessment, to be broadcast by public television stations, that will also include a viewer's guide and local publicity materials. * A Community Education Kit containing a Leader's Guide, Parent's Handbook, and short videotapes. Project materials and activities are designed for parents of elementary-age children, with a specific emphasis for materials on grades 3-5.
